Thalia TM100 A-SUP for Clotho Drive Unit:
- The diaphragm Alternating-Single-Use-Pump (SUP) integrate no valves. And as to such simplified operation only exchange broth forth and back – all along the HFF. The HFF receive broth from the SUB and return the same broth volume back through the HFF to the SUB
- The A-SUP dome is designed with ¾ TRI-clamp flange and hereby fits the HFF coupling
- The A-SUP optionally fitted with HFF direct connected for ultra low shear stress
- The A-SUP operation is controlled by the super compact Clotho Drive Unit which insure exchange of broth volume
Its easy to see that no valve body is included within the A-SUP. So, the Thalia is not a pump - but a broth exchanger. Insuring dual directional broth flow. Described also as alternating broth flow or reciprocating broth flow.
